They just file the corrosion off and all tickety-boo. Great service every time from the lads here.Buying a kit on ebay to repair a car tyre has a number of potential problems.
1. The kit - in my experience the quality of ebay bought products is not always of the required standard for mission critical activities
2. Training - using these kits requires training. The single biggest part of the training is an assessment on whether the tyre is suitable for repair.
If you value your safety and the safety of your passengers get a pro to do it
